Yoshie Takeshita 竹下 佳江
*18.03 1978 in Kitakyūshū
height: 1,59 m / 5 ft 3 in
Nummer 3 as setter
plays for JT Marvelous in Japan
First time for Japan All Stars Team: 1997 

One reason for being a huge fan of this team is Yoshie Takeshita. Watch her play and you will understand. She is a player that gives 200% for every ball. Don't be disturbed by her height of 1,59 m or the age of 34 - that has no meaning in her case. If she wanted to she could be even attacking due to her attacking reach of 2.80 m. Being even a very good digger makes her an absolutely essential all-a-round player. 
But most important of all is that Yoshie Takeshita is one of the best setters in the world. Many times she was honored as "Best setter" (World Cup 2012, WGP 2009, WGP 2008, OQT 2008, WCC 2006) and as "Most valuable player" in 2006
Whenever Erika Araki is not positioned in the squad she acts as the team captain. So she did several times at the WGP 2012.


Yoshie Takeshita played in Japan for JT Marvelous among Ai Yamamoto. This year (2011/2012) their team reached the 5th place in the japanese V-League.

Actual news say that she retired from international and domestic volleyball. 
The japanese wikipedia gives information of her becoming the wife of a japanese baseball player Takashi Egusa.

 Yamamoto, Ai 山本 愛
*2403 1982 in Sendai, Miyagi
height: 1,84 m / 6 ft 0 in
Nummer 5 as middle blocker
plays for JT Marvelous (2012)
First time for Japan All Stars Team: 1998
Ai Yamamoto is the player with the highest reach in the team and an important middle blocker. Her first appearance was in 2002 at the world championship when reaching with the japanese volleyball team the 13th place. Back then her name was Otomo. After marrying and getting her daughter in 2006 she returned in 2008 to the V. premier league. Because of a knee injury in 2011 she could not play at the world cup in Japan 2011. In 2012 she was reintroduced in the prelementary round of the FiVB World Grand Prix again with her old maiden name Ai Otomo.

 Yamaguchi, Mai 山口 舞
*0307 1983 in Shima, Mie
height: 1,76 m / 5 ft 9 1/2 in
spike: 298 cm / 117 in
Nummer 7 as wing spiker until 2012
Number 7 as middle blocker 2014
plays for Okayama Seagulls (2012)
first time Japan All Stars Team: 2009
Mai Yamaguchi is an inspiring volleyball player. Her playing is very creative due to powerful spikes or very powerless BUT more intelligent "hand" play. The way she plays depends on the current situation. If there is a strong block the ball can be set shortly behind or from the block touch out of field. Often Mai Yamaguchi takes a leading role in fast and intelligent combination play which represents the japanese volleyball team. Due to her beauty and her play she has a huge fan base with many videos.

2014

In season 2013/2014 she became captain of her team Okayama Seagulls where she plays as a middle blocker who had a very tremendous scoring rate of over 50% successes. In matches against very high players like the Russians she took often a key role as opposite spiker. After one year of break (from international court) and recovery of an achilles injury she reappeared in the new role of Japans smallest middle blocker.

Ebata, Yukiko 江畑 幸子
*0711 1989 in Akita
height: 1,76 m / 5 ft 9 1/2 in
spike: 305 cm/ 120 in
Nummer 14 as wing spiker
plays for Hitachi Rivale (2012)
First time for Japan All Stars Team: 2010
Yukiko Ebata is currently next to Saori Kimura the most important spiker - even without being one of the highest players. She has very powerful and incisive attacks. At the Montreux Volley Masters 2011 she was honored as the best attacker (of all teams) with a spike success of 50 %.

Sakoda, Saori
*1812. 1987 in Kagoshima
height: 1,75 m / 5 ft 9  in
spike: 305 cm/ 120 in
Nummer 16 as wing spiker
plays for Toray Arrows (2012)
First time for Japan All Stars Team: 2010

 Saori Sakodas jumping ability is what makes that girl such a phenomena. Even being one of the smaller players her attacks reaches higher than Saori Kimura's who is 10 cm/ 3,9 in higher. Her strengths are the attacks from the back field which are very hard to block.

It's a tactic decision when she comes into action because her position is the same as Yukiko Ebatas. Her first real international acknowledgment was in 2011 at the Montreux Masters when team Japan could turn whole matches with her coming to the field.   

May 2013: Due to a shoulder trauma Saori Sakoda can not be a part of the national volleyball team. Probably having the major role in the Japanese Volleyball league at Toray Arrows she overstressed her skills a little. I really hope and wish to see her soon in the squad.
